African and Africana philosophy

African and Africana philosophy is philosophical work on African and diasporic histories, colonial power, racialization, and liberation.

Shared questions

  • How should concepts formed under colonial domination be revised, refused, or repurposed?

Internal disagreements

  • Whether Africana philosophy is defined chiefly by geography, racialized experience, political struggle, or a plurality of intellectual lineages.

Key texts

  • The Souls of Black Folk · 1903 — Du Bois's essays gave the tradition its vocabulary of double consciousness and the colour line.
  • African Philosophy: Myth and Reality · 1976 — Hountondji's critique of ethnophilosophy set the methodological argument the field has since worked through.
